How to Use Crabgrass for Health Benefits

Internal Use:

For internal ailments such as inflammation, digestion, or fever, crabgrass can be made into a tea. Simply boil a handful of fresh crabgrass leaves and stems in half a liter of water for 5 minutes. Strain and enjoy a cup of the tea once or twice a day to experience its health benefits.

External Use:

For skin irritations or minor wounds, crush fresh crabgrass leaves and apply them directly to the affected area as a poultice. The anti-inflammatory and soothing properties of crabgrass will help reduce irritation and promote healing.
